Tottenham head coach Mauricio Pochettino is convinced that attacking "spurs" Harry Kane is able to become even better.
The hat trick at the gate Burnley helped Harry Kane repeat the 22-year record of Alan Shearer in the number of goals in the Premier League over the calendar year - 36.
"Alan was a fantastic player who maintained consistency for over a decade. This deserves great respect, "- said Pochettino.
"Harry is now doing a good job, and we hope that he will continue in the same spirit, because when you have such a player in your team, it's fantastic. I hope and wish him every season to score 15 or more goals ".
"I believe that he is still able to add. He is 24 years old, and usually peak at 27, 28, 29 years old. It all depends on his professionalism. It is important that he retains the mentality that now demonstrates ".
In the current season, Kane scored 21 goals and gave three assists in 23 games for Tottenham in all tournaments.
